December 15, 2020
SAB Biotherapeutics Announces New Appointments to its Board of Directors
December 16, 2020 06:00AM CENTRAL STANDARD TIME SIOUX, FALLS, SD–SAB Biotherapeutics (SAB), a clinical-stage biopharmaceutical company developing a novel immunotherapy…